Transaction 67e2756433c00b2054a0e07d8e2c0ca416db5e69a75435f11338b19bdeec3c2d
1 Input
1 Output
-
67e2756433c00b2054a0e07d8e2c0ca416db5e69a75435f11338b19bdeec3c2d:0
- value
- 99978688
- script pubkey
- OP_0 OP_PUSHBYTES_20 30a018f62cceed341652640e72acb60b888c2979
- address
- bc1qxzsp3a3vemkng9jjvs889t9kpwygc2tenfq09a